362.700. Agreement for merger becomes effective, when.

Agreement for merger becomes effective, when.

362.700. 1. If the agreement is so approved and ratified by thestockholders of each of the respective banks and trust companies, then incase the agreement provides for a merger, a copy of the minutes of therespective stockholders' meetings at which the agreement is approved, witha copy of the agreement and the director's approval thereof, all certifiedand verified by the respective secretaries of the meetings, shall be filedin the public records of the division of finance, and a like copy of theminutes, agreement and approval shall be filed with the cashier orsecretary of each of the banks and trust companies which are parties to theagreement.

2. Upon the filing for record of the copies as herein required to befiled, the agreement and merger shall become effective according to itsterms.

(L. 1967 p. 445, A.L. 2000 S.B. 896)

(Source: RSMo 1959 § 363.860)
